The Division of Water Pollution Control (WPC) is responsible for managing the sanitary sewage and stormwater drainage collection systems in Cleveland. The system is comprised of 1,200 miles of sewer lines with attendant catch basins and includes the maintenance of 18 pump stations. The sewer collection system transfers sanitary sewage and stormwater drainage from its point of origin to treatment facilities for processing and disposal.
